Imperial Federation Map


The turn of the century saw some groups advocate plans for an imperial federation with a federal parliament or government based in London. Canada and Australia appeared to provide a blueprint for how to achieve a federal model. The stumbling block appeared to be the British parliament itself which was loathe to dilute its own powers and large swathes of the British public who did not wish to subsidise any new organisation nor end up paying more for their goods and food by limiting trade and imposing customs duties on imports.
